// RUN: not llvm-mc -arch=amdgcn -mcpu=tahiti -show-encoding %s | FileCheck -check-prefix=GCN -check-prefix=SI -check-prefix=SICI %s
// RUN: not llvm-mc -arch=amdgcn -mcpu=bonaire -show-encoding %s | FileCheck -check-prefix=GCN -check-prefix=CI -check-prefix=SICI %s
// RUN: not llvm-mc -arch=amdgcn -mcpu=tonga -show-encoding %s | FileCheck -check-prefix=GCN -check-prefix=VI %s
// RUN: not llvm-mc -arch=amdgcn -mcpu=tahiti %s 2>&1 | FileCheck -check-prefixes=GCN-ERR,SICI-ERR --implicit-check-not=error: %s
// RUN: not llvm-mc -arch=amdgcn -mcpu=bonaire %s 2>&1 | FileCheck -check-prefixes=GCN-ERR,SICI-ERR --implicit-check-not=error: %s
// RUN: not llvm-mc -arch=amdgcn -mcpu=tonga %s 2>&1 | FileCheck -check-prefixes=GCN-ERR,VI-ERR --implicit-check-not=error: %s
//===----------------------------------------------------------------------===//
// Positive tests for legacy dfmt/nfmt syntax.
//===----------------------------------------------------------------------===//
tbuffer_load_format_x v1, off, s[4:7], dfmt:15, nfmt:2, s1
// SICI: tbuffer_load_format_x v1, off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x00,0x78,0xe9,0x00,0x01,0x01,0x01]
// VI: tbuffer_load_format_x v1, off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x00,0x78,0xe9,0x00,0x01,0x01,0x01]
tbuffer_load_format_xy v[1:2], off, s[4:7], dfmt:15, nfmt:2, s1
// SICI: tbuffer_load_format_xy v[1:2], off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x00,0x79,0xe9,0x00,0x01,0x01,0x01]
// VI: tbuffer_load_format_xy v[1:2], off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x80,0x78,0xe9,0x00,0x01,0x01,0x01]
tbuffer_load_format_xyz v[1:3], off, s[4:7], dfmt:15, nfmt:2, s1
// SICI: tbuffer_load_format_xyz v[1:3], off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x00,0x7a,0xe9,0x00,0x01,0x01,0x01]
// VI: tbuffer_load_format_xyz v[1:3], off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x00,0x79,0xe9,0x00,0x01,0x01,0x01]
tbuffer_load_format_xyzw v[1:4], off, s[4:7], dfmt:15, nfmt:2, s1
// SICI: tbuffer_load_format_xyzw v[1:4], off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x00,0x7b,0xe9,0x00,0x01,0x01,0x01]
// VI: tbuffer_load_format_xyzw v[1:4], off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x80,0x79,0xe9,0x00,0x01,0x01,0x01]
tbuffer_store_format_x v1, off, s[4:7], dfmt:15, nfmt:2, s1
// SICI: tbuffer_store_format_x v1, off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x00,0x7c,0xe9,0x00,0x01,0x01,0x01]
// VI: tbuffer_store_format_x v1, off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x00,0x7a,0xe9,0x00,0x01,0x01,0x01]
tbuffer_store_format_xy v[1:2], off, s[4:7], dfmt:15, nfmt:2, s1
// SICI: tbuffer_store_format_xy v[1:2], off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x00,0x7d,0xe9,0x00,0x01,0x01,0x01]
// VI: tbuffer_store_format_xy v[1:2], off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x80,0x7a,0xe9,0x00,0x01,0x01,0x01]
tbuffer_store_format_xyzw v[1:4], off, s[4:7], dfmt:15, nfmt:2, s1
// SICI: tbuffer_store_format_xyzw v[1:4], off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x00,0x7f,0xe9,0x00,0x01,0x01,0x01]
// VI: tbuffer_store_format_xyzw v[1:4], off, s[4:7], s1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x80,0x7b,0xe9,0x00,0x01,0x01,0x01]
t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], dfmt:15, nfmt:2, ttmp1
// SICI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x00,0x7f,0xe9,0x00,0x01,0x1d,0x71]
// VI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x80,0x7b,0xe9,0x00,0x01,0x1d,0x71]
// nfmt is optional:
t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], dfmt:15, ttmp1
// SICI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_RESERVED_15] ; encoding: [0x00,0x00,0x7f,0xe8,0x00,0x01,0x1d,0x71]
// VI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_RESERVED_15] ; encoding: [0x00,0x80,0x7b,0xe8,0x00,0x01,0x1d,0x71]
// dfmt is optional:
t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], nfmt:2, ttmp1
// SICI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x00,0x0f,0xe9,0x00,0x01,0x1d,0x71]
// VI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x80,0x0b,0xe9,0x00,0x01,0x1d,0x71]
// nfmt and dfmt can be in either order:
t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], nfmt:2, dfmt:15, ttmp1
// SICI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x00,0x7f,0xe9,0x00,0x01,0x1d,0x71]
// VI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_USCALED] ; encoding: [0x00,0x80,0x7b,0xe9,0x00,0x01,0x1d,0x71]
// nfmt and dfmt may be omitted:
t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1
// SICI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 ; encoding: [0x00,0x00,0x0f,0xe8,0x00,0x01,0x1d,0x71]
// VI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 ; encoding: [0x00,0x80,0x0b,0xe8,0x00,0x01,0x1d,0x71]
// Check dfmt/nfmt min values
t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], dfmt:0, nfmt:0, ttmp1
// SICI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_INVALID] ; encoding: [0x00,0x00,0x07,0xe8,0x00,0x01,0x1d,0x71]
// VI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_INVALID] ; encoding: [0x00,0x80,0x03,0xe8,0x00,0x01,0x1d,0x71]
// Check dfmt/nfmt max values
t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], dfmt:15, nfmt:7, ttmp1
// SICI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_FLOAT] ; encoding: [0x00,0x00,0xff,0xeb,0x00,0x01,0x1d,0x71]
// VI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_FLOAT] ; encoding: [0x00,0x80,0xfb,0xeb,0x00,0x01,0x1d,0x71]
// Check default dfmt/nfmt values
t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], dfmt:1, nfmt:0, ttmp1
// SICI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 ; encoding: [0x00,0x00,0x0f,0xe8,0x00,0x01,0x1d,0x71]
// VI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 ; encoding: [0x00,0x80,0x0b,0xe8,0x00,0x01,0x1d,0x71]
// Check that comma separators are optional
t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7] dfmt:15 nfmt:7 ttmp1
// SICI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_FLOAT] ; encoding: [0x00,0x00,0xff,0xeb,0x00,0x01,0x1d,0x71]
// VI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_FLOAT] ; encoding: [0x00,0x80,0xfb,0xeb,0x00,0x01,0x1d,0x71]
dfmt=15
nfmt=7
// Check expressions with dfmt
t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7] dfmt:-1+dfmt+1 nfmt:nfmt ttmp1
// SICI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_FLOAT] ; encoding: [0x00,0x00,0xff,0xeb,0x00,0x01,0x1d,0x71]
// VI: tbuffer_store_format_xyzw v[1:4], off, ttmp[4:7], ttmp1 format:[BUF_DATA_FORMAT_RESERVED_15,BUF_NUM_FORMAT_FLOAT] ; encoding: [0x00,0x80,0xfb,0xeb,0x00,0x01,0x1d,0x71]
